Genes At Work
Since its founding in 1976, Genentech has fostered a culture of casual intensity that has consistently led to success. In 1996, among the three regulatory clearances achieved by its workforce was a new indication for ActivaseÆ (Alteplase, recombinant) for the treatment of acute ischemic stroke within the first three hours of symptom onset. As a result, the medical community for the first time recognizes ischemic stroke as a treatable medical emergency.
Statement by Genentech Cofounder Herber W. Boyer
"Genentech's unique culture is no accident. At the very beginning we planned to bring the best characteristics of an academic environment to the Genentech corporate culture. We hired the most competent, enthusiastic people we could find, provided a stimulating, challenging, yet supportive environment, and encouraged publication, peer interaction, and open communication.
